037430a379beb6304bc1fa30bbfed2166373c4c80ddea8209fc7860827733052

1656797 (21060 blocks ago)

⏴ Block 1656796 (770ce777...ca5) | Block 1656798 ⏵ | Latest block ⏭

Metadata

22/8/24, 6:36 pm UTC (29d 6:00:14 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details